What Is a Velocity Calculator?
A velocity calculator is a digital utility that computes speed using the basic physics formula:
Velocity = Distance ÷ Time
It simplifies the process of converting raw numbers into meaningful speed values. Instead of manually dividing and converting units, the tool handles everything instantly and accurately.

Practical Examples of Velocity Calculator
Example 1: Road Trip Speed Calculation
A car travels 150 km in 3 hours.
- Distance = 150 km
- Time = 3 hours
Velocity = 150 ÷ 3 = 50 km/h
This helps travelers understand average driving speed during trips.
Example 2: Running Speed in Sports
A runner covers 400 meters in 50 seconds.
- Distance = 400 m
- Time = 50 s
Velocity = 400 ÷ 50 = 8 m/s
This is commonly used in athletics to measure performance.
